Attention Artists: GO Registration Closes Friday

The community-curated exhibit GO will open at the Brooklyn Museum in December, but artists must register now.

Does your art belong in the big leagues? Now's your chance to have it shown at the Brooklyn Museum.

GO, a community-curated art show, empowers the Brooklyn art-loving public to vote on the local work they want to see appear in a special exhibit at the Brooklyn Museum, set to debut on Dec. 1.

Participating artists must have a studio in Brooklyn, and have it open to the public during GO's open studio weekend on Sept. 8 and 9. Registered voters will stop by the studios, and vote on which artist's work they'd like to see appear in the exhibition.

The deadline for artist registration is coming up fast—participants must enter by Friday, June 29. Voter registration opens on Aug. 1.

So far, 1128 artists in 67 neighborhoods around the borough have registered, according to GO's website.
